Magnetic Strip Technology 🧲💻

Magnetic strip: secure and simple data storage.

 

M agnetic strip is a data storage technology commonly used on credit cards, containing iron-based particles for encoding information.

Magnetic strip technology is the most common type of credit card technology used today. Here are some key points to understand how it works:  

How it works: A magnetic strip is a strip of magnetic material that is laminated onto a plastic card. The strip contains tiny iron-based magnetic particles in a plastic-like binder. When the strip is swiped through a card reader, the magnetic particles are arranged in a specific pattern, which is read by the reader.

Information stored: The magnetic strip stores three tracks of data🪪-- track 1, track 2, and track 3. Each track can hold different types of data, including account numbers, names, and expiration dates📆.

Vulnerabilities: Magnetic strips are vulnerable to demagnetization and scratch damage🧲 , which can make the data unreadable. They are also less secure than other technologies, such as EMV chips.

Replacement: If a magnetic strip 🧲 is damaged or no longer functioning, a replacement card will need to be issued.

Overall, magnetic strip🧲 technology has been a reliable and convenient option for many years. However, as technology continues to advance and security concerns grow, other options such as EMV chips are becoming more popular.

Demagnetization🔌🧲

When a credit card 🪪is demagnetized, it can no longer be read by a card reader. Demagnetization can happen due to various reasons, including exposure to magnets or scratches on the magnetic strip. Here's what you need to know about demagnetization:

Signs of Demagnetization:

  • Difficulty swiping the card
  • Multiple attempts needed to read the card
  • Error messages when using the card

Causes of demagnetization:

  • Exposure to magnets: Exposure to magnets, including the magnets in cell phone holders, wallets, and other electronic devices⚡. 
  • Repeated swiping: Repeated swiping, which can wear down the magnetic strip over time. 🔄
  • Magnets: Strong magnetic fields can erase the data stored on a magnetic strip.
  • Scratches: Even small scratches can damage the strip and cause it to malfunction, disrupt the magnetic field and prevent the card from being read. 🤕
  • Heat: High temperatures can demagnetize the strip over time.
  • Wear and Tear: Over time, the strip can wear out due to regular use.

Effects of demagnetization:

  • Inability to complete transactions, as the card reader cannot read the card. 💳
  • Potential for fraudulent activity, as the cardholder may need to provide sensitive information to complete a transaction without their card. 🚫
  • The need for a replacement card, which can be a hassle and may come with additional fees. 💸

Preventing demagnetization:

  • Store credit cards separately from magnets, including cell phone holders and wallets. 🔍
  • Keep credit cards away from items that could scratch the magnetic strip. 🚫
  • Use a card protector or wallet with RFID blocking technology to protect against unauthorized scanning. 🔒
  • Store cards away from magnetic fields, including cell phone holders, magnets, and other electronic devices.
  • Keep cards in a wallet or cardholder to protect them from scratches and wear.
  • Use chip-enabled cards instead of magnetic strip cards, as they are less susceptible to demagnetization.

It is important to take precautions to prevent demagnetization. A demagnetized credit card🪪 can cause a lot of inconveniences. However, if your credit card does become demagnetized, it's relatively easy to get a replacement card from your issuer.

 

Magnet Damage💔🧲

Damaged magnet, lost attraction.

Magnets can cause damage to various items, including credit cards, phones, and batteries. Here's what you need to know about magnet damage:

Credit Cards:

  • Magnets can erase the data on a magnetic stripe, rendering the card useless.
  • The strength of the magnet required to damage a card depends on the card's magnetic stripe technology.
  • EMV chip cards are not susceptible to magnet damage.

Phones:

  • Magnets can interfere with a phone's compass, causing navigation issues.
  • However, modern smartphones are not typically susceptible to permanent magnet damage.

Batteries:

  • Magnets can cause a battery to become demagnetized, leading to reduced performance.
  • However, it is unlikely that a typical household magnet would cause permanent damage.

Airpods:

  • Magnets can damage the charging case, which has magnets that hold the earbuds in place.
  • Strong magnets may interfere with the AirPods' functionality.

Wireless Charging:

  • Magnets can interfere with wireless charging technology, causing slower charging or failure to charge.
  • However, most phone cases with built-in magnets are designed to avoid interference with wireless charging.

Electronics:

  • Magnets can cause damage to hard drives, causing data loss.
  • Magnets can also interfere with other electronic components, causing malfunction.

Overall, while magnets🧲 can cause damage to certain items, it's unlikely that typical household magnets will cause permanent damage to modern electronic devices. However, it's still best to avoid exposing your devices to magnets whenever possible..

 

Scratch Damage💥🔪

Another common type of damage that credit cards can experience is scratch damage. This can happen when the card comes into contact with rough or abrasive surfaces, such as keys or coins in a pocket or purse. While this type of damage is not as serious as demagnetization or magnet damage, it can still affect the usability of the card. Here are some things to keep in mind:

  • Some common causes of scratch damage include keeping the card in the same pocket or compartment as keys or coins or allowing the card to rub against other cards or surfaces in a wallet or purse.
  • You can check for scratch damage by inspecting the surface of the card for any visible marks or blemishes.
  • To protect your card from scratch damage, consider keeping it in a separate compartment or sleeve in your wallet or purse. You can also consider using a protective case or cover for your card.
  • If your card becomes scratched to the point where it affects its usability, you can contact your card issuer to request a replacement card. In some cases, they may charge a fee for this service.

By taking a few simple precautions❌, you can help prevent scratch damage to your credit card🪪 and ensure that it continues to function properly when you need it..

Common Questions 🤔❓

Magnetic Strip Technology FAQ

If you're still seeking clarity on credit card damage, take a look at these frequently asked questions:

Will magnets🧲 ruin Credit Cards?

Magnets can damage the magnetic stripe on credit cards and render them unreadable, but it's unlikely that a standard fridge magnet or phone holder would have enough magnetic force to cause permanent damage. However, strong magnets such as those used in MRI machines or industrial equipment can potentially cause damage to credit cards. It's always best to keep credit cards away from strong magnets and magnetic fields to avoid any risk of damage.

Will magnets ruin phone?

Strong magnets can potentially damage certain components of a phone, such as the hard drive or the screen, depending on their strength and how close they are to the device. However, everyday use of a phone near magnets like those found in phone holders and wallets is unlikely to cause damage. It is always best to keep your phone away from strong magnets and magnetic fields to avoid any potential damage.

Will magnets ruin  Batteries?

A: Magnets can affect batteries in certain situations, but it depends on the type of battery. Alkaline and lithium batteries are not significantly affected by magnets, while rechargeable batteries such as nickel-cadmium (NiCad) and nickel-metal hydride (NiMH) can be damaged or even lose their charge when exposed to a strong magnetic field for an extended period of time. It's generally best to avoid exposing any type of battery to strong magnets to prevent any potential damage.

Will magnets ruin  airpods?

Airpods contain magnets as part of their design, so exposure to external magnets is not likely to ruin them. However, strong magnets may cause some interference with the Airpods' wireless connection or speakers. It is recommended to avoid exposing them to strong magnetic fields as a precaution.

Will magnets ruin  wireless charging?

It depends on the strength and placement of the magnets. If the magnets are too strong and placed too close to the wireless charging device, they may interfere with the charging process or damage the charging components. It's generally recommended to keep magnets away from wireless charging devices to avoid any potential damage.

Will magnets ruin  electronics?

Magnets can potentially damage or interfere with electronics, depending on the strength and proximity of the magnetic field. Strong magnets, such as neodymium magnets, can cause permanent damage to electronics, while weaker magnets may only cause temporary interference. It's important to keep magnets away from sensitive electronic devices such as hard drives, credit cards, and pacemakers to avoid any potential damage or malfunction.

Can a scratched credit card still be used?

It depends on the extent of the damage. Minor scratches usually don't affect the magnetic strip or chip, but deep scratches can cause problems. If your card is severely scratched, it's best to get a replacement..
